    Israel Torres

    When you are watching this series you are feeling Superman is one of the greatest heroes in comics history. This series contains every details about Superman history. The history of his planet Kripton are the first three episodes of the season. You will learn about his weakness, his enemies and his friends through the episodes.Later in series you will see Superman teaming with another greats superheroes like Batman, Flash, Green Lantern and more. The episodes of Superman and Batman are excellent because are mixing enemies from both series. I recommend to watch Word's Finest episodes.Lex Luthor is the main enemy of Superman but you will see in action more enemies like Metallo, Darkseid, Braniac, Joker and more. I like this series because Superman appear like he can be beaten. He have all the magnificent powers but the enemies are smart and they can destroy Superman if they want it. This make suspense in the series.This is a very short series compared with Batman animated show. But every episodes are great and you don't wanna miss any one of them.I recommend this series.
